2020 AFT rankings of the most active French primary dealers

FRANCE
  • The AFT has released its annual league table of the most active primary dealers (SVTS).
  • According to AFT "A score is allocated to each of the 15 SVTs, based on a 100-point-total, with a weighting of 40 points for their participation at auctions, 30 points for their presence in the secondary market and 30 points for their qualitative contribution."
  • The league table is as follows:
  1. BNP Paribas
  2. HSBC
  3. J.P. Morgan
  4. Credit Agricole
  5. Societe Generale
  6. Citigroup
  7. Deutsche Bank
  8. Barclays
  9. BofA Securities Europe SA
  10. Nomura
